Sankey charts have become an increasingly popular tool for visualizing flow and connectivity data in recent years. These unique and visually striking charts are capable of revealing complex relationships between data points in a way that is both intuitive and aesthetically pleasing, making them a valuable asset for data visualization professionals. In this article, we’ll explore the benefits of using Sankey charts, how to create them, and the various applications they can be used for.
Benefits of Sankey Charts
Sankey charts are primarily used to depict the flow of material, energy, or information through a system. These charts enable the viewer to understand not only the quantity of flow between different points but also the direction and nature of the connections. Here are some key advantages of using Sankey charts:
1. Insightful for Complex Data
Sankey charts are particularly adept at revealing patterns and connections in large, complex datasets that might be difficult to discern otherwise. They help data analysts and researchers identify bottlenecks, dependencies, and flow structures within the data.
2. Visually Engaging and Attractive
The aesthetic appeal of Sankey charts, with their intricate flows and vibrant colors, makes them engaging and easy to understand. They are visually pleasing, which can help maintain audience attention and ensure that important insights are not overlooked.
3. Facilitating Comparisons
Sankey charts allow for easy comparisons between different sets of data, making it simple to identify changes and fluctuations in flow patterns. This is especially useful in industries where understanding temporal dynamics is crucial, such as in supply chain management, energy usage, or traffic flow analysis.
4. Enhancing Decision-Making
By visualizing the flow and connectivity of data, Sankey charts aid in the decision-making process by highlighting critical paths and areas for optimization. This insight can lead to strategic improvements in operational efficiency, resource allocation, and project management.
How to Create Sankey Charts
Creating a Sankey chart involves several steps, including data preparation, chart generation, and customization to ensure the visualization effectively communicates the intended message. Here’s a simplified guide on how to create a Sankey chart:
1. Data Preparation
- Collect Data: Gather the necessary data representing the flow you want to visualize. This data should include the source, target, and magnitude of the flow for each connection.
- Organize Data: Structure your data in a table where each row represents a connection. Ensure you have columns for the source, target, and flow quantity.
2. Choose a Tool
- Select a Chart Type: Decide on the tool you’ll use to create the chart. Popular choices include software like Microsoft Excel, specialized data visualization packages like Tableau, or programming libraries such as Plotly and Gephi.
- Prepare Your Tool: Set up your chosen tool for Sankey chart creation by selecting the appropriate template or library function if applicable.
3. Input Data
- Import Dataset: Import your structured data into the chosen tool and ensure it maps correctly to the chart’s source, target, and flow quantity fields.
- Configure Parameters: Adjust the settings to specify parameters such as color coding for different flows, size of the nodes representing sources and targets, and layout of the connections to enhance readability.
4. Customize and Finalize
- Adjust Visuals: Customize the appearance of your chart, including colors, labels, and sizes. Ensure that the chart is not overcrowded and all elements are legible.
- Review and Validate: Double-check the accuracy of the data representation in your chart. Ensure that all connections and flow quantities are correctly visualized.
- Export: Once satisfied, export the chart in a format suitable for your intended use, such as a high-resolution image or interactive web-based chart.
Applications of Sankey Charts
Sankey charts find applications across various sectors due to their ability to illustrate flow patterns effectively:
1. Supply Chain Management
- Sankey charts are used to visualize and analyze the flow of goods and materials throughout a supply chain, helping businesses identify inefficiencies and optimize their logistics.
2. Energy Analysis
- In energy sector applications, Sankey diagrams can show the origins, distribution, and consumption of energy resources, guiding strategies towards sustainability and efficiency improvements.
3. Environmental Studies
- These charts can represent the flow of nutrients, pollutants, or energy in ecological systems, aiding in understanding and managing environmental impacts.
4. Transportation Networks
- Sankey diagrams help in visualizing passenger flows in transportation systems, such as bus lines, subway networks, or road networks, assisting in route planning and resource allocation.
5. Web Traffic Analysis
- In web analytics, Sankey charts can be used to depict user journeys across a website, providing insights into areas of high or low engagement and guiding website design improvements.
In conclusion, Sankey charts offer a comprehensive and visually appealing way to uncover the essential details behind the flow and connectivity data within your organization or project. By leveraging the power of these charts, professionals across various industries can benefit from enhanced data understanding, efficient decision-making, and improved operational strategies.
SankeyMaster
SankeyMaster is your go-to tool for creating complex Sankey charts . Easily enter data and create Sankey charts that accurately reveal intricate data relationships.